Conquering the Art of Float Fishing: Techniques & Tips
Float fishing presents a unique set of abilities that can lead rewarding catches. It necessitates patience, observation, and an understanding of your chosen waters. Those Just Starting Out should focus on mastering the foundations first. This includes identifying the appropriate float, coupling your hook and bait properly, and casting your line with precision.
- Practice your casting technique until you can consistently place your float in the desired spot.
- Monitor the float's actions. A subtle sink indicates a potential bite.
- Remain calm and hope for the float to fully go under before setting the hook.
By cultivating these skills, you'll be well on your way to experiencing the thrill of float fishing.
